Comments (6)Two years ago I decided to experiment and see which potted roses did better - those I buried or those I stuck in the garage. It was a real chore to dig the deep trenches and bury the roses, but I would be willing to do it if it was best. In the spring, I dug up the buried roses and brought out the garage guys. Those that wintered in the garage looked much better right off the bat, budded out quiicker, were much more free of canker and other disease, and performed twice as well that summer. Needless to say, all my potted roses go in the garage now.
